Try this and let us know what happens.

  1. Take the 510 screw out from the bottom assembly
  2. Then try turning the control ring and see if it catches the threads on the deck
  3. You should then be able to turn the control ring clock-wise ring until there's no gap left (like in your picture)
  4. If you can do that ....
  5. Then put the 510 screw back into the bottom assembly
  6. Turn the screw just until you feel it 'stop'
  7. Check that the control ring still turns easily in both directions
  8. If it doesn't loosen the 510 screw just a bit, then try turning the control in both directions again.

I would replace both A8 and B17. The threads mate to each other and if one's damaged, the other most likely is as well.

Kayfun v4 Replacement Parts - EVcigarettes.com

Parts are made by EHpro, one of the better clone makers. A8 is $6.49 and B17 is $8.99
